CADICA (Spanish: Confederación Atlética del Istmo Centroamericano; Central American Isthmus Athletic Confederation) is the regional confederation governing body of athletics for national governing bodies and multi-national federations within Central America.
The organization was founded in 1964, shortly before the second Central American Championships in Athletics were held.[1] The current president is Roberto Verdesia from Costa Rica.[2]
Championships
CADICA organizes the following championships:[3]
- Central American Senior Championships in Athletics (Campeonatos Centroamericanos Mayores)
- Central American Junior (Under-20) and Youth (Under-18) Championships (Campeonatos Centroamericanos Juvenil A y B)
- Central American Age Group (Under-16 and Under-14) Championships (Campeonatos Centroamericanos Juvenil C y Infantil A)
- Central American Cross Country Championships (Campeonatos Centroamericanos de Campo Traviesa)
- Central American Race Walking Championships (Campeonatos Centroamericanos de Marcha), formerly: Central American Race Walking Cup (Copa Centroamericana de Marcha)
Member associations
CADICA consists of 7 member federations.[4] 6 of them are members of NACAC, while Panamá is member of CONSUDATLE. Moreover, all 7 are also members of CACAC.
